What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Traverse City to Boston?

The average price of all flights from Traverse City to Boston cl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.
When flying from Traverse City to Boston, you should consider leaving on a Wednesday and avoid Sundays if you are looking for the best rates. For your return to Traverse City, you’ll find the best rates on Tuesdays and the most expensive ones on Fridays.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Traverse City to Boston?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Traverse City to Boston,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from Traverse City to Boston is January, where tickets cost $360 on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are March and April, where the average cost of tickets is $617 and $515 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Traverse City to Boston?

To calculate daily average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each day before departure over the last year for flights from Traverse City to Boston,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each month.
To get a below average price on the flight from Traverse City to Boston, you should book around 2 weeks before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 41 days before departure.

Which airlines fly non-stop between Traverse City and Boston?

Airline and price data is aggregated from results in KAYAK’s search results from the last 2 weeks for flights from Traverse City to Boston.
There are 2 airlines that fly nonstop from Traverse City to Boston. They are American Airlines and Delta. The cheapest airline for this route is American Airlines, with the best one-way deal found costing $308. On average, the best prices for this route can be found at American Airlines.

How many flights are there between Traverse City and Boston per day?

Each day, there are between 1 and 2 nonstop flights that take off from Traverse City and land in Boston, with an average flight time of 2h 06m. The most common departure time is 11:00 am and most flights take off in the afternoon. Each week, there are 9 flights. The most frequent day of departure is Sunday, when 22% of all weekly flights depart. The fewest flights depart on a Thursday.

How long does a flight from Traverse City to Boston take?

The average nonstop flight takes 2h 03m, covering a distance of 746 miles.
